About Ciambra
Ciambra in Monreale is a contemporary Sicilian seafood restaurant with a smart-casual dress code and an expected spend of about $60 per person. The clearest reason to consider it is the fish-led cooking: seafood crudo, fresh daily catch, refined Sicilian pasta dishes, tiramisu are the dishes to keep in mind.

Venue details
Ambiance
Elegant yet warm Sicilian seafood restaurant with great attention to detail in décor, flowers, table settings, and art, creating a magical, relaxing atmosphere with an open kitchen that guests describe as enchanting and memorable.
